How do you allocate budgets across different channels within a campaign?

I recommend starting by modeling out the forecasted results. Once you have these estimates, you can better determine the contribution by each channel, which will help you allocate the percentage of spend accordingly.
I would also consider reallocating the budget once you have data and a better understanding of performance. If a channel is not working, ideally, you should be able to shift the budget to a channel that is performing well.
Lastly, you'll also want to consider how this is factored across different geographies, if applicable to your organization.
